摘 要:通过对四川省部分地区大米和小麦两种主粮中杂色曲霉菌(A.v)和杂色曲霉素(ST)污染调查,结果表明在大米和小麦中,A.v污染率分别为5.5%和10.5%;ST污染率为53.4%和65.8%;ST平均含量为15.5μg/kg和58.6μg/kg。对不同地区和不同贮藏期粮食进行分析,A.v检出率越高,粮食中ST污染率和含量越高;贮藏期延长,A.v和ST检出率及ST含量增高。实验产毒表明所有A.v菌株均能产生ST,平均产毒量达7190.2μg/kg,证实A.おn investigation on the contamination of Aspergillus versicolor(A.v) and sterigmatocystin(ST) in main grains was carried out in Sichuan province.The results show that in rice and wheat,the contamination rates of A.v were 5 5% and 10 5% respectively and that of were ST 53 4% and 65 8% respectively.The average contents of ST in rice and wheat were 15 5 μg/kg and 58 6μg/kg respectively.Through the comparison of the grains collected from different areas and different storage duration,it was found that the higher the detection rate of A.v,the higher contamination rate and content of ST in grains, as the storage period prolonged,the detection rate of A.v and ST,and content of ST increased.The toxigenic experiments show that all A.v strains produced ST and the average toxin production reached 7190 2μg/kg.It was proved that the A.v is the main fungus produces ST.
